Hi All,

I'm new to OpenZaurus and Opie, previously been using Sharp 1.32 rom with overclocked Kernel on my 5600.  I installed OpenZaurus 3.5.1 today which runs very smoothly and looks great.  

However, after installing OpenZaurus, I can't seem to hit it anymore over USB.  Previously I was using Zaurus Manager to set to USB-TCP/IP setting so I could use FileZilla to transfer files, as well as use ssh from cygwin console.  Now I can not even ping it.  

I've tried changing the settings in Networking for usbd0 to use a fixed IP address of 192.168.129.201, subnet mask of 255.255.255.0, and gateway of 192.168.129.200.  This doesn't seem to do anything.  

Also, I tried using Qtopia Desktop 1.7 to sync with Zaurus but without luck.  QTDesktop doesn't seem to find the Zaurus.

Okay, it seems that the IP from the Zaurus Manager program is used.  If I manually put in an IP on the Network Connections in XP (Local Connection 3 for me), I can ping the Zaurus.  However, that's about all I can do.  I can't ftp, ssh, telnet, or anything.  I tried these settings:

Ethernet adapter Local Area Connection 3:

        Connection-specific DNS Suffix  . :
        IP Address. . . . . . . . . . . . : 192.168.129.201
        Subnet Mask . . . . . . . . . . . : 255.255.255.0
        Default Gateway . . . . . . . . . : 192.168.129.200

for both the network connection on WinXP as well as on the usbd0 setting on the Zaurus itself.  

If I ssh, I get:

ssh: connect to host 192.168.129.201 port 22: Connection refused

Dropbear seems to be running on my zaurus, and I have no firewalls enabled on my XP machine.

Quote
Connection-specific DNS Suffix . :
IP Address. . . . . . . . . . . . : 192.168.129.201

and

Quote
ssh: connect to host 192.168.129.201 port 22: Connection refused

IP addresses must be different. Try 192.168.129.200 for the XP end of the connection; then use the ssh command as you used above.
